RARE 18th-CENTURY IRISH SILVER TEASPOON
Antique circa 1775 George III Irish solid sterling silver teaspoon.
Bottom stamped hallmarks.
No personal monograms or crests.
A good quality, genuine 18th-century Irish antique silver spoon of around 240 years old.
Bottom stamped 18th-century Irish teaspoons are rarely available.
HALLMARKS:Dublin, STERLINGfineness92.5% MAKERWilliam Ward
DATE:c1775
DIMENSION: 13.2cm (5 1/4\") long approx.
SILVER WEIGHT:13.5g
CONDITION:Great condition for its age. No nasty dents, no splits, no repairs.
